KW-37

The KW-37, code named JASON, was an encryption system developed In the 1950s by the U.S. National Security Agency to protect fleet broadcasts of the U.S. Navy. Naval doctrine calls for warships at sea to maintain radio silence to the maximum extent possible to prevent ships from being located by potential adversaries using radio direction finding. To allow ships to receive messages and orders, the navy broadcast a continuous stream of information, originally in Morse code and later using radioteletype. Messages were included in this stream as needed and could be for individual ships, battle groups or the fleet as a whole. Each ship's radio room would monitor the broadcast and decode and forward those messages directed at her to the appropriate officer. The KW-37 was designed to automate this process. It consisted of two major components, the KWR-37 receive unit and the KWT-37 transmit unit. Each ship had a complement of KWR-37 receivers that decrypted the fleet broadcast and fed the output to teleprinter machines. KWT-37's were typically located at shore facilities, where high power transmitters were located.

Experiences operating the KWR-37
Typically, fleet units utilizing the KWR-37 units were outfitted with two devices for redundancy. Should one unit fail, the other one would already be online and patches via a high level, 60-milliamp patch panel would quickly be changed around so that the current offline unit could be changed over to online status at a moment's notice, to ensure that there was no interruption of message traffic. Later in their life, when KWR-37 units were aged and worn, sometimes the circuit cards inside had to be reseated with a rubber mallet which helped ensure the cards were seated properly. Other problems with the KWR-37's were related to the startup times. Fleet radiomen, and those stationed in the shore transmitting stations, had to listen to an HF signal for coordinated universal time. Radiomen called this broadcast the "time tick," which gave them a sharp tone, signalling them to press the restart button so that the unit could then start up for "new day" or otherwise known as "HJ's" by the radiomen. This took place after the new day's crypto keylist card was properly inserted into the "crib" or the card reader by securing it onto pins and then firmly closing the card access door and then locking it with a key. Once the unit(s) were restarted, the key was placed back in the safe using two-person integrity (TPI) which was stringently enforced following the Walker spy investigation. In the early nineties when the KWR-37 units were retired from the navy and replaced by the more reliable and modern KWR-46's, fleet Radiomen breathed a sigh of relief because the KWR-37 units were often unreliable and would occasionally fall out of synchronization timing, resulting in a loss of broadcast messages from the various fleet channels. ==Sources==
